The TLM 107 Studio Set (008673) is the ultimate "workhorse" for project and professional studios alike. Unlike traditional microphones that favor a "vintage" warmth, the TLM 107 is engineered for breathtaking realism and sonic neutrality. It features five selectable polar patterns and a transformerless (TLM) circuit that captures everything from a whisper to thundering percussion with a massive 131 dB dynamic range. By bundling the microphone with the dedicated EA 4 shock mount, this set ensures your signal remains pristine and free from mechanical vibrations.
Product Description
The Modern Studio Workhorse:
The TLM 107 is designed for those who prefer an uncolored, true-to-the-source sound. Its newly developed dual-diaphragm capsule is inspired by Neumann’s top-of-the-line D-01 digital microphone, offering an incredibly balanced frequency response across all patterns. Whether you are using Omni, Wide Cardioid, Cardioid, Hypercardioid, or Figure-8, the overall sound balance remains consistent, allowing you to change patterns to suit the room without needing to re-EQ your source.
Innovative Navigation Concept:
Setting a new standard for user interface, the TLM 107 features a stylish navigation toggle on the rear of the microphone. This joystick-style control allows you to manage the polar pattern, two stages of pre-attenuation (0, -6, -12 dB), and two low-cut filters (Linear, 40 Hz, 100 Hz) from a single point. Clear LED indicators display your current settings and are programmed to dim automatically after ten seconds so as not to distract the performer during a take.
Precision Engineering & Transient Response:
The sound of the TLM 107 remains remarkably linear up to 8 kHz, followed by a slight, elegant lift in the highest frequencies to add "freshness" and "air" to vocals. Particular attention has been paid to the natural reproduction of speech sounds, specifically the critical “s” sound, to prevent sibilance. Because the capsule is edge-terminated and the grille is acoustically optimized, the microphone is significantly less sensitive to humidity, dust, and pop sounds.
Versatility for High-Pressure Recording:
Despite its refined sound, the TLM 107 is exceptionally robust. With its pre-attenuation pads engaged, it can handle sound pressure levels up to 153 dB SPL. This makes it equally suitable for delicate classical ensembles and aggressive sound sources like loud guitar amplifiers or drums. Its ultra-low self-noise of just 10 dB-A is virtually inaudible, ensuring that your recordings remain clean even in the quietest studio environments.
Key Features
Five Selectable Polar Patterns: Omni, Wide Cardioid, Cardioid, Hypercardioid, and Figure-8.
Innovative Joy-Stick Control: Intuitive navigation switch with LED-illuminated settings.
All-New Capsule Design: Outstanding impulse fidelity and balanced frequency response.
Transformerless (TLM) Circuitry: Ultra-transparent sound with massive dynamic range.
Extreme SPL Handling: Manages up to 153 dB (with pad) without distortion.
Variable High-Pass & Pad: Flexible settings (40/100 Hz and -6/-12 dB) for any scenario.
Complete Studio Set: Includes the EA 4 elastic suspension for superior isolation.
